Welcome to the very first episode of Courageously Unbothered! Today, Sonia McDonald tackles the all-too-familiar struggle of people pleasing. In this episode, you’ll learn: - What people pleasing is and why so many of us do it. - The hidden costs of constantly saying "yes" when you mean "no." - How people-pleasing steals your energy, authenticity, and joy. - Sonia’s practical tips for breaking free from approval addiction, including: - Reframing criticism and not letting others’ opinions define you. - The power of saying “no” and setting boundaries. - Why you need to stop apologising for taking up space. - Embracing the courage to be disliked and focusing on what matters. - Sonia also shares personal stories, neuroscience-backed insights, and book recommendations to help you start living boldly and authentically. Mentioned in this Episode: - Sonia’s books: Leadership Attitude, Just Rock It!, and First Comes Courage. - Book Recommendations: The Courage to Be Disliked and You Are a Badass. - Tools for defining your values: Visit Leadership HQ or Google “Values tools.” Key Takeaway: Stop playing small, start setting boundaries, and live for yourself—not for the approval of others.
